Sleeper: Joe Flacco, Cincinnati Bengals
It didn't take long for quarterback Joe Flacco to figure out that targeting Ja'Marr Chase early and often was a good idea. In his second start for the Cincinnati Bengals, Flacco found Chase 16 times for 161 yards and a touchdown.
Flacco gashed the Pittsburgh Steelers defense to the tune of 342 passing yards and three touchdowns last Thursday night.
Moving forward, Flacco should be a solid matchup-based streamer, and he has a reasonable matchup in Week 8. The Bengals will host the New York Jets, who have surrendered an average of 21 fantasy points to opposing quarterbacks.
Flacco is rostered in just 11 percent of Yahoo leagues and five percent of ESPN leagues.

Sleeper: Kyle Monangai, Chicago Bears
Chicago Bears rookie running back Kyle Monangai is starting to carve out a role in the offense. While he's still the clear-cut backup to D'Andre Swift, he got a big opportunity against the New Orleans Saints on Sunday and thrived.
Monangai racked up 81 yards and a touchdown on 13 carries and added two catches for 13 more yards.
This week, the Bears will visit the Baltimore Ravens, who have surrendered an average of 26.5 fantasy points to opposing backfields this season. There's a chance that Baltimore's defense will show improvement coming out of its bye, but Monangai remains one of the few enticing waiver options at RB this week.
Monangai is rostered in just seven percent of Yahoo leagues and four percent of ESPN leagues.

Sleeper: Kayshon Boutte, New England Patriots
Second-year New England Patriots quarterback Drake Maye is quietly playing like an MVP candidate, and it's raised the fantasy value of Kayshon Boutte significantly.
Two weeks ago Boutte had his second huge game of the season, finishing with five catches for 93 yards and two touchdowns. He had a more modest outing in Week 7 but still finished with two catches, 55 yards and a touchdown.
This week, the Patriots will host the Cleveland Browns. While Cleveland's defense has been solid overall, it has had breakdowns in the secondary, leaving the unit markedly average against opposing receivers. Cleveland has surrendered an average of 29.7 fantasy points to receiver groups this season, making for a mid-level matchup for Boutte.
Boutte is rostered in 32 percent of Yahoo leagues and 27 percent of ESPN leagues.

Sleeper: Pat Freiermuth, Pittsburgh Steelers
Steelers tight end Pat Freiermuth has fallen off the fantasy map in 2025, largely because offensive coordinator Arthur Smith has been involving so many tight ends in the passing game. In Week 7, for example, Freiermuth, Jonnu Smith and Darnell Washington all had multiple receptions and a receiving touchdown.
As a result of Pittsburgh's rotation, Freiermuth is only rostered in seven percent of Yahoo leagues and five percent of ESPN leagues.
Freiermuth will likely see some action on the waiver wire this week after he caught five passes for 111 yards and two touchdowns against the Cincinnati Bengals. He's a decent sleeper play in Week 8 too.
While Freiermuth probably won't replicate last week's numbers against the Green Bay Packers, he could still thrive. No team has surrendered more fantasy points to opposing tight ends than Green Bay.
